Riverview Park and West Wyomissing are places in Pennsylvania. This page compares them across population, income, housing, education, commuting, and how each has changed since 2019.

Riverview Park has the higher population (3,647 vs 3,263 in West Wyomissing). Riverview Park has the higher median household income ($111,000 vs $75,944 in West Wyomissing). Riverview Park has the higher median home value ($248,100 vs $180,500 in West Wyomissing).
